Hadoop: Soluciones big Data

Boris Lublinsky; Kevin T. Smith; Alexey Yakubovich · Anaya Multimedia

Ver Precio
Envío a todo Chile

Reseña del libro

Este libro explica cómo trabajan juntas las numerosas partes del ecosistema Hadoop y cómo se pueden utilizar para construir soluciones adaptadas a la empresa. Aprenderá cómo realizar el diseño de datos y su impacto en la implementación, al mismo tiempo que verá cómo funciona MapReduce y cómo reformular problemas concretos. Encontrará ejemplos detallados de código Java que puede utilizar, derivados de aplicaciones que han sido construidas e implantadas con éxito.HADOOP. SOLCION DE CONTENIDOSIntroducciónA quién va dirigido este libroContenidosEstructuraConvencionesCódigo fuente1. Big Data y el ecosistema HadoopBig Data y HadoopEl ecosistema HadoopComponentes principales de HadoopDistribuciones HadoopDesarrollo de aplicaciones de uso empresarial con HadoopResumen2. Almacenar datos en HadoopDescargas de código para este capítuloHDFSHBaseCombinar HDFS yHBase para el almacenamiento de datos efectivoApache AvroAdministrar metadatos con HCatalogSeleccionar una organización de datos de Hadoop adecuadaResumen3. Procesamiento de datos con MapReduceIntroducción a MapReduceLa primera aplicación MapReduceDiseñar implementaciones MapReduceResumen4. Personalizar la ejecución de MapReduceDescargas de código para este capítuloControlar la ejecución de MapReduce con InputFormatLeer datos con RecordReader personalizadosOrganizar datos de salida con formatos personalizadosEscribir datos con RecordReader personalizadoOptimizar la ejecución de MapReduce con un combinadorControlar la ejecución del reductor con particionadoresUtilizar código distinto de Java con HadoopResumen5. Construir aplicaciones fiables de MapReduceDescargas de código para este capítuloComprobación unitaria de aplicaciones de MapReduceComprobación de aplicaciones locales con EclipseUtilizar el registro para la comprobación de HadoopInformes de métricas con contadores de trabajoProgramación defensiva en MapReduceResumen6. Automatizar el procesamiento de datos con OozieIntroducción a OozieWorkflowCoordinator de OozieBundle de OozieParametrización de Oozie con lenguaje de expresionesModelo de ejecución de trabajos de OozieAcceder a OozieSLA de OozieResumen7. OozieDescargas de código para este capítuloValidar información sobre lugares utilizando probesDiseñar validación de lugares basada en probesDiseñar Workflows de OozieImplementar aplicaciones Workflow de OozieImplementar actividades WorkflowImplementar aplicaciones Coordinator de OozieImplementar aplicaciones Bundle de OozieDesplegar, comprobar y analizar las aplicaciones de OozieUtilizar la consola de Oozie para obtener información sobre aplicaciones OozieResumen8. Herramientas avanzadas de OozieDescargas de código para este capítuloConstruir acciones Workflow de Oozie personalizadasAñadir ejecución dinámica a los Workflows de OozieUtilizar el API Java de OozieUtilizar uber jars con aplicaciones OozieTransportador para la incorporación de datosResumen9. Hadoop en tiempo realDescargas de código para este capítuloAplicaciones en tiempo real en el mundo realUtilizar HBase para implementar aplicaciones en tiempo realUtilizar sistemas de consultas especializados de tiempo real en HadoopUtilizar sistemas de procesamiento de eventos basados en HadoopResumen10. La seguridad en HadoopHistoria breve: comprender los retos de seguridad en HadoopAutentificaciónAutorizaciónAutentificación y autorización de OozieEncriptación de redMejoras de seguridad con Project RhinoRecopilación. Buenas prácticas para proteger HadoopResumen11. Ejecutar aplicaciones de Hadoop en AWSDescargas de código para este capítuloIntroducción a AWSOpciones para ejecutar Hadoop en AWSComprender la relación entre EMR y HadoopUtilizar S3 de AWSAutomatizar la ejecución y la creación de un flujo de trabajo EMROrganizar ejecución de trabajos en EMRResumen12. Construir soluciones de seguridad empresarial para las implementaciones de HadoopPreocupaciones de seguridad para las aplicaciones de empresaElementos que la seguridad de Hadoop no proporciona de manera nativa para las aplicaciones de empresaEnfoques para las aplicaciones de seguridad en la empresa con HadoopResumen13. El futuro de HadoopSimplificar la programación de MapReduce con DSLProcesamiento más rápido y ampliableMejoras de seguridadTendencias emergentesResumenApéndice. Lecturas recomendadasAlmacenamiento y acceso de los datos de HadoopMapReduceOozieHadoop en tiempo realAWSDSL de Hadoop&n alfabético

Opiniones del Libro

Opiniones sobre Buscalibre

Ver más opiniones de clientes